Grafana graph api
Grafana graph api
Grafana graph api. # grafana # node # javascript # database Data visualization is important for harnessing the value in the data we have at our disposal. Powered by Grafana k6. We recommend using the Infinity data source plugin instead) The Grafana JSON Datasource plugin empowers you to seamlessly integrate JSON data into Grafana. 4, HTTP API details are specified using OpenAPI v2. If the application role received by Grafana is GrafanaAdmin, Grafana grants the user server administrator privileges. Get your metrics into Prometheus quickly Alerting provisioning HTTP API. There is hardly any help on this on Google. The sort param is an optional comma separated list of options to order the search result. Self-managed. Try out and share prebuilt visualizations. Add and configure datasource plugin in your Grafana instance. I’m using oauth to authenticate to get to the web application, and I would prefer not to use anonymous authentication for that, but I don’t mind anonymous authentication Panel options. Refer to Role-based access control permissions for more information. I don't know how the JSON should look like so that Grafana can print the node graph. RBAC API Role-based access control API is only available in Grafana Cloud or Grafana Enterprise. Path: Copied! with Grafana Alerting, Grafana Incident, Grafana OnCall, and Grafana SLO. When you migrate an API key to a service Configure options for Grafana's node graph visualization. snapshot name; expires - Optional. You use the Service Graph to detect performance issues; track increases in error, fault, or throttle rates in services; and investigate root causes by viewing corresponding traces. I’m trying to embed a Grafana graph on my web page, currently as an Iframe. This is useful if you want to grant server administrator privileges to a subset of users. To check which basic or fixed roles have the required permissions, refer to RBAC role definitions. Assign server administrator privileges. Compared to API keys, service accounts have limited scopes that provide more security. . Get status GET /api/access-control/status Find the Grafana endpoint URL: In the Azure portal, enter Azure Managed Grafana in the Search resources, services, and docs (G+ /) bar. Deploy The Stack. Nodegraph API Plugin for Grafana. The Alerting Provisioning HTTP API can be used to create, modify, and delete resources relevant to Grafana-managed alerts. Accepted values for the sort filter are: login-asc, login-desc, email-asc, email-desc, name-asc, name-desc, I have a Grafana dashboard with existing graphs and stats. Each node on the graph represents a service such as an API or database. Or they can be tied to a panel on a dashboard and are then only shown on that panel. A node graph requires a specific shape of the data to be able to display its nodes and edges. We’ll demo how to get started using the LGTM Stack: Loki for logs, Grafana for visualization, Tempo for traces, and Mimir for metrics. JSON is a versatile and widely used data format, and with this plugin, you Hi, Currently, we are downloading the graphs data into csv file through Grafana Dashboard which is a manual process. Identifier (id) vs unique Grafana HTTP API. The Grafana backend exposes an HTTP API, which is the same API that is used by the frontend to do everything from saving dashboards, creating users, and updating data sources. A flame graph takes advantage of the hierarchical nature of profiling data. It is signed and published by Grafana. Grafana通过插件的形式提供了多种 Panel的实现,常用的如:Graph Panel,Heatmap Panel,SingleStat Panel以及Table Panel等。用户还可通过插件安装更多类型的Panel面板。除了Panel以外,在Dashboard页面中,我们还可以定义一个Row(行),来组织和管理一组相关的Panel。除了Panel Default value for the perpage parameter is 1000 and for the page parameter is 1. I hardly see any tutorials anywhere. I understand from this thread here that an API Key can’t authenticate the UI (shucks!). Dashboard API. Getting started with the Grafana LGTM Stack. Requires basic authentication and that the authenticated user is a Grafana Admin. This visualization is ideal for displaying large numbers of timed data points that would be hard to track in a table or list. When the snapshot should expire in seconds. ), let’s say I have a simple block code as this: export default function () { get_Data_User(); update_NewUser(); } On Grafana k6 doc, it seems that k6 did not have this type of measurement yet, only having below call, but logging on API keys specify a role—either Admin, Editor, or Viewer—that determine the permissions associated with interacting with Grafana. JSON Body schema: dashboard – Required. Hint: It starts at FREE. Annotations are saved in the Grafana database (sqlite, mysql or postgres). 3600 is 1 hour, 86400 is 1 day. Pricing. Complete Guide: How to use Grafana with a custom Node API. In the Panel options section of the panel editor pane, set basic options like panel title and description, as well as panel links. Modes Flame graph mode. Get your metrics into Prometheus quickly Click Save. Now I want to add new graphs automatically to my current dashboard. As far as I can refer to Grafana's HTTP API documentation, there're only ones to create new dashboard but not graph, stats, etc. Do we have any API which directly download graphs information in csv same as we are doing from dashboard. If you are running Grafana Enterprise, for some endpoints you’ll need to have specific permissions. name – Optional. If you want to use this as a data source developer see the section about data API. Grafana Loki. For more information on the differences between Grafana-managed and data source-managed alerts, refer to Introduction to alert rules. Is there a way to do this? Monitor your incoming metrics data or log entries and set up your Grafana Alerting system to watch for specific events or circumstances. Fully managed. Read more about Grafana Enterprise. The API can be used to create, update, delete, get, and list roles. Open Source All. Select Overview from the left menu and save the Endpoint value. It condenses data into a format that allows you to easily see I am trying to generate a directed node graph using Grafana (latest). In this way, you eliminate the need for manual monitoring and provide a first line of defense against system outages or changes that could turn into major incidents. 2 and later versions. Prometheus exporters. Multi-tenant log aggregation system. Following the Hackathon — and recognizing the value of AI in helping with flame graph analysis — we accelerated the development of the AI-powered flame graph tool, refining it based on extensive user feedback. I’m using oauth to authenticate to get to the web appli… Community resources. Annotations can be organization annotations that can be shown on any dashboard by configuring an annotation data source - they are filtered by tags. This means not every data source or query can be visualized with this graph. A time series visualization displays an x-y graph with time progression on the x-axis and the magnitude of the values on the y-axis. Get an access token. The complete dashboard model. For more information on the benefits of service accounts, refer to service account benefits. Secondly, try this command for a curl localhost or replace localhost by your ip address; To install the plugin see the example for loki-stack. To learn more, refer to Configure panel options. Annotations API. This API is the one used by our Grafana Terraform provider. Synthetic Monitoring. As baseUrl you can enter URL to your metrics service API Use Flame graph AI to better understand your profile data and flame graphs. Dashboard templates. Display the Service Graph. Grafana Cloud. Configure Grafana Alloy or Tempo or GET to generate Service Use the Service Graph and Service Graph view Yo, Firstly, generate an API KEY since interface admin Grafana then copy the key (also you can define a timelife). JSON API data source for Grafana (NOTE: this plugin is now in maintenance mode, no new features will be added. Select Azure Managed Grafana and open your Managed Grafana workspace. Open Source. Is there a way to do this? I’m trying to embed a Grafana graph on my web page, currently as an Iframe. I’m using oauth to authenticate to get to the web appli… A node graph requires a specific shape of the data to be able to display its nodes and edges. Flame graph AI uses the LLM plugin for Grafana to provide an LLM using the OpenAI API. Available in Grafana v9. I have a Grafana dashboard with existing graphs and stats. To access Grafana APIs, you need Folder API. Any help is Community resources. This plugin provides a data source to connect a REST API to nodegraph panel of Grafana. Grafana Enterprise. The feature has graduated from I’m having 2 APIs to be executed and I need to see response time distribution of each API (p95, p99 etc. Since version 8. I can expose an API which reads JSON data from disk and gives it to Grafana which can display the graph. Identifier (id) vs unique identifier (uid) with Grafana Alerting, Grafana Incident, Grafana OnCall, and Grafana SLO. jzofitt uwddeky cbdz tqpl amb lubih ielj cyu xuifa exoljy